About Measles, Mumps, Rubella (MMR) Testing
Overview
Measles, Mumps, Rubella (MMR) Testing is a diagnostic test that checks for immunity to these three viral infections: measles, mumps, and rubella. The MMR vaccine is highly effective in preventing these diseases, but some individuals may not develop sufficient immunity after vaccination. MMR Testing helps determine whether a person is immune to these viruses, ensuring adequate protection and preventing outbreaks of these contagious diseases.

Tests Included in Measles, Mumps, Rubella (MMR) Testing
MMR Testing typically involves:
- Measles Antibody Test
- Mumps Antibody Test
- Rubella Antibody Test
Interpreting the Results
The interpretation of MMR Testing results involves assessing the presence of specific antibodies to measles, mumps, and rubella viruses. Positive results indicate immunity to the respective virus, while negative results suggest the need for vaccination or booster doses to achieve adequate protection.
